Let's try this again: CCRT Autumn ride.
The usual suspects know all about it, and all others welcome.Sunday Oct 10th at the Dennis trailhead. C&V themed but anything acceptable. Generally kicks off about 10 AM.
Didn't happen last year at all and the spring ride VERY sparsely attended. Lets see some folks enjoy fall on the Cape!
